No, in fact it’s the best idea! That means that all of your content should still be there, safe and secure.
What do you mean when you say “haven’t activated the site yet”? Are you using a temporary URL provided by your hosting service until your domain name propagates, or is there something different happening?
I only ask because shutting down your laptop or local computer should have absolutely no effect on your remote site. Your changes are actually being saved on the remote server, rather than on your local machine.

Sometimes editing in multiple tabs can cause a headache, but it wouldn’t cause all of your posts, pages, tags and media to suddenly disappear. If the site isn’t live yet, it sounds like a temporary URL issue, or an issue with whatever plugin you’re using for keeping the site private during development.
